Кодовый замок

Тема в разделе "Arduino & Shields", создана пользователем Рокки1945, 14 май 2016.

  1. Рокки1945

    Рокки1945 Гуру

    не в скетче есть массив
     
  2. Benny_Ray

    Benny_Ray Нерд

    скетч нормально вставьте в код а не просто в сообщение, так не видно что там массив т.к то что в квадратных скобках не отображается
     
  3. Рокки1945

    Рокки1945 Гуру

    ну я все сделал
     
  4. Benny_Ray

    Benny_Ray Нерд

    на 13 порт что выведено?
     
  5. Рокки1945

    Рокки1945 Гуру

    светодиод
     
  6. Рокки1945

    Рокки1945 Гуру

    вот может задержку какую нибудь между цифрами поставить чтобы 0 нули не проскакивали
     
  7. Рокки1945

    Рокки1945 Гуру

    был такой же пример?
     
  8. Рокки1945

    Рокки1945 Гуру

    заработала:)
     
  9. Benny_Ray

    Benny_Ray Нерд

    если взять за основу хотя бы просто проверку чтения то
    то

    Код (C++):
    #include <TTP229.h>
    const byte SCL_PIN = 2; // The pin number of the clock pin.
    const byte SDO_PIN = 3; // The pin number of the data pin.
    TTP229 ttp229(SCL_PIN, SDO_PIN); // TTP229(sclPin, sdoPin)


    void setup()
    {
      Serial.begin(9600);
    }

    void loop()
    {
        key = ttp229.ReadKey16();
        Serial.println(key);
    }
    и нажать каждую кнопку по очереди с задержкой в секунду, гляньте что прилетает в порт в этот момент.
     
  10. Benny_Ray

    Benny_Ray Нерд

    рассказывайте и как, вдруг еще кому понадобится.
     
  11. Benny_Ray

    Benny_Ray Нерд

    я даже не сомневался, мое любимое delay() ))) Ладно, единственное что посоветую проверить, это набрать код неправильно или не с той цифры, будет ли оно работать.
     
  12. Рокки1945

    Рокки1945 Гуру

    работает
     
  13. Benny_Ray

    Benny_Ray Нерд

    значит замечательно )
     
  14. Рокки1945

    Рокки1945 Гуру

    причем спасибо автору - и нам за доработку
     
  15. Рокки1945

    Рокки1945 Гуру

    сказка
     
  16. Benny_Ray

    Benny_Ray Нерд

    )) теперь прицепите два светодиода (красный и зеленый) и если код правильный то загорается зеленый если код неверный то красный.
     
  17. Рокки1945

    Рокки1945 Гуру

    в субботу:)
     
  18. Рокки1945

    Рокки1945 Гуру

    клавиатура подвержена наводкам - учтите
     
  19. rivald

    rivald Нуб

    рокки1945 привет, можешь выложить рабочий скетч
     
  20. mcureenab

    mcureenab Гуру

    ReadKey16(), // Wait for a key to be touched, then return its index(1 - 16) (When released return 0).

    0 код отпускания кнопки